Simply put, a hyperlink, or link, is a piece of text or an image that, when clicked, takes a user to another location on the internet. This location can be another page on your website, an external website, or even a specific section within the same page (an anchor link).
Why are hyperlinks so important? They’re the connective tissue of the web, guiding users through your content and driving conversions. Without effective hyperlinking, your website becomes a disconnected island, failing to leverage the power of internal and external connections.

Beyond the Basics: Advanced Hyperlinking Strategies
Effective hyperlinking goes beyond simply connecting pages. Consider these advanced strategies:
- Internal Linking: Linking between pages on your website improves SEO and user navigation. Strategic internal linking guides users deeper into your content, increasing engagement and time on site.
- External Linking: Linking to authoritative external sources builds credibility and provides users with additional resources. However, avoid excessive external links that detract from your own content.
- Contextual Linking: Ensure your links are relevant to the surrounding text. Avoid generic or misleading anchor text.
- Anchor Text Optimization: Use descriptive and keyword-rich anchor text to improve SEO and user understanding.
